What Does Pevi-calyceal System Of Fetal Right Kidney Is Dilated Indicate?
The Palcenta is right lateral and above the internal os. High The Pevi-calyceal system of fetal right kidney is dilated and measures 14mm during the time of overdistened bladder ,however it was measured 11mm is postvoid status otherwise normal growth parameters
Main finding is mild dilatation of renal pelvis of fetal right kidney.This condition is called as pyelectasis in which there is mild dilatation of fetal renal pelvis in AP diameter. It is the most common fetal abnormality detected on prenatal ultrasound examination.
You need follow up scan.In may resolves with the progression of pregnancy.It is important to know about the amount of amniotic fluid and status of ureter.
If dilatation of renal pelvis persists,then it can be managed even after birth. Baby may need antibiotics and few investigations.Since there is only mild dilatation,we can expect better results.Let's hope for the best.
